Have you heard of Ionic Silver, also called Colloidal Silver? Ionic or Colloidal silver is a liquid solution, usually water, that has microscopic particles of silver dissolved or suspended in it. Depending on how it's produced, colloidal silver has powerful, natural antibacterial qualities and has been recognized for thousands of years for its medical usefulness. It was the prescription of choice among doctors for treating infection and disease in both America and Europe before antibiotics arrived on the scene in the mid-1900's. Throughout much of history, tests and research have shown that silver is effective against hundreds of different diseases and ailments affecting both humans and animals. It may sound odd to think that a metal can have such positive effects on the human body, but in fact, our bodies thrive on many different metals. Our blood, for example, is full of iron. And potassium is used extensively in the nervous system.
Because of how it works, colloidal silver has the extra benefit that bacteria have a hard time growing resistant to it, unlike what happens with the overuse of antibiotics. Colloidal silver can be made multiple ways, and not all products of silver are exactly the same. Colloidal silver can even be produced at home, with the help of a colloidal silver generator, a process known as electrolysis, that uses an electrical current to strip the silver down and ionize it in water, which I intend to document in a later hub.

Archaeological evidence has shown that cultures even in ancient times used silver plates to treat and speed wound healing, and drank from silver cups to prevent beverages from spoiling. Hippocrates himself, the Father of Medicine, noted that Silver promoted the healing of wounds and helped control disease. Some cultures also bathed their newborns in bathwater mixed with powdered silver as protection from the germs they would encounter in the world around them.
Have you ever heard the expression "Born with a silver spoon in his mouth"? Upper class nobility who could afford such luxuries would feed their children from silver spoons because they knew the silver offered protection from the diseases that ran rampant around them. Also, farmers would routinely throw silver coins into their drinking wells and pails of milk to prevent the contents from becoming foul or spoiling. Silver nitrate drops, for a long time, were put into the eyes of newborn babied to prevent blindness.
